Final Theses in Theoretical Philosophy
Students can write bachelor’s, master’s, and state examination theses at the Chair in all core areas of the discipline: epistemology, philosophy of language, metaphysics, logic, and philosophy of mind.
How to Proceed
As of March 2025, you will no longer be required to find your own two reviewers. You will register your thesis project using the Institute’s form, and reviewers will be assigned centrally; the person who serves as the primary reviewer will also supervise your writing process. You can find all the details and the form under “Assignment of Reviewers for Theses.”
Please register by January 15 if you wish to begin in the summer semester, or by July 15 for the winter semester.
Before Registering
It is recommended that you discuss your topic in advance during an office hour. Even if the Chair is currently vacant, theses in Theoretical Philosophy are supervised without restriction. You can find your contact persons under “Faculty and Staff.”
